Lonely Hearts DVD Review
February 26, 2008
Lonely Hearts is loosely based on the true story of Martha Beck (played by Salma Hayek) and Ray Fernandez (played by Jared Leto), who were dubbed the Lonely Hearts Killers and murdered as many as 20 women in the late 1940s. The pair finds their victims, wealthy women, through the personal ads, takes all their money and then murders them in the most heinous ways.
Bye Bye HD DVD
February 26, 2008
Last week, electronics maker Toshiba said it will no longer develop, make or market HD DVD players and recorders, which leaves Blu-ray disc technology as the go-to format for any future video electronics.
